Abstract

The utility model discloses an LED light source component for a car lamp, which comprises a PCB and a plurality of LEDs arranged on the PCB; the LED comprises a heat dissipation base and at least two light emitting chips with different colors and focus points; the heat dissipation base is fixedly connected to the circuit board through pins; the light emitting chips are arranged in parallel and fixedly connected to the end face of the heat dissipation base; on the PCB, the quantity of one side of each luminous chip relative to the geometric center of each LED is basically consistent with that of the other side. According to the utility model, the number of each light-emitting chip on the PCB is basically consistent with that of the other side of each LED geometric center, so that the maximum light intensity of each light type is at the right center, the phenomenon of deviation can not occur, the light type is good in positive and lighting uniformity and visual through, and the efficiency of the vehicle lamp in function multiplexing is improved.

Background
Along with the current car light structure is more and more compact, car light integration degree is higher and higher, the function, the colour of current car light are also more and more, generally, the daytime is with white light, turn to with yellow light, red light for braking, the light of different colours needs to use different light sources, a plurality of light sources share one light inlet end collimation structure such as spotlight ware or speculum, however because the focus of a light inlet end collimation structure is only one, because a plurality of light sources can't all be in focus department, this has led to the inefficiency of whole optical system, each functional light type is partial to influence the lighting effect of car light and problem such as heat, consumption, cost.
Therefore, it is necessary to design an LED light source assembly for a vehicle lamp to solve the above-mentioned problems.
Disclosure of utility model
The utility model aims at overcoming the defects of the prior art and provides an LED light source assembly for a car lamp.
The technical scheme of the utility model is as follows: an LED light source assembly for a car lamp comprises a PCB and a plurality of LEDs arranged on the PCB; the LED comprises a heat dissipation base and at least two light emitting chips with different colors and focus points; the heat dissipation base is fixedly connected to the circuit board through pins; the light emitting chips are arranged in parallel and fixedly connected to the end face of the heat dissipation base; on the PCB, the quantity of one side of each luminous chip relative to the geometric center of each LED is basically consistent with that of the other side.
The number of the light emitting chips is two, and the light emitting chips are respectively marked as A and B; the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B is as follows: AB BA … ….
The number of the light emitting chips is two, and the light emitting chips are respectively marked as A and B; the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B is as follows: AB BA BA AB … ….
The number of the light emitting chips is two, and the light emitting chips are respectively marked as A and B; the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B is as follows: AB BA BA … ….
The chips of each light emitting chip can be rotated by an arbitrary angle along the central axis thereof in the light emitting direction.
The LED light source assembly for the car lamp further comprises a light guide structure arranged on the front side of the LED light source assembly; the light guide structure is provided with a light emitting end and a light entering end opposite to the LED light source assembly.
By adopting the technical scheme, the utility model has the following beneficial effects: (1) According to the utility model, the number of each light-emitting chip on the PCB is basically consistent with that of the other side of each LED geometric center, so that the maximum light intensity of each light type is at the right center, the phenomenon of deviation can not occur, the light type is good in positive and lighting uniformity and visual through, and the efficiency of the vehicle lamp in function multiplexing is improved.

Detailed Description
Example 1
Referring to fig. 1 and 6, an LED light source assembly for a vehicle lamp according to the present embodiment includes a PCB board 1 and a plurality of LEDs 2 disposed on the PCB board 1; the LED comprises a heat dissipation base and at least two light emitting chips with different colors and focus points; the heat dissipation base is fixedly connected to the circuit board through pins; the light emitting chips are arranged in parallel and fixedly connected to the end face of the heat dissipation base; on the PCB 1, the number of each light emitting chip is basically consistent with that of the other side of each LED geometric center.
Further, the number of the light emitting chips is preferably two, and the light emitting chips are respectively marked as A and B; the quantity of A and B meets the quantity of the two sides |A-B| less than or equal to (A+B)/5; the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B is as follows: AB BA … …. The LEDs 2 of the present embodiment are also arranged in a plurality of rows, and the number and the rotation angle are not limited, and the LEDs of the present embodiment may also be arranged in three chips or four chips.
Further, each light emitting chip can be rotated by an arbitrary angle along its central axis in the light emitting direction.
Further, the embodiment further comprises a light guide structure 3 arranged at the front side of the LED light source assembly; the light guide structure 3 is provided with a light emitting end 3-1 and a light entering end 3-2 opposite to the LED light source assembly. Furthermore, the light guiding structure 3 is preferably made of transparent material, and may be an aluminized reflector, a light guiding body, or the like.
Example 2
Referring to fig. 2, this embodiment is substantially the same as embodiment 1 except that: the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B board in this embodiment is: AB BA BA AB … ….
Example 3
Referring to fig. 3, this embodiment is substantially the same as embodiment 1 except that: the arrangement mode of the light emitting chips on the PCB board in this embodiment is: AB BA BA … ….
Example 4
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, the present embodiment is based on embodiments 1 to 3, in which each LED2 can be rotated by an arbitrary angle along its central axis in the light emitting direction, to meet the installation requirements of different lamps.
According to the utility model, the number of each light-emitting chip on the PCB 1 is basically consistent with that of the other side of each LED geometric center, so that the maximum light intensity of each light type is at the right center, the phenomenon of deviation can not occur, the light type is good in positive and lighting uniformity and visual through, and the efficiency of the vehicle lamp in function multiplexing is improved.
